Iran conflict could flip China’s deflation into ‘bad inflation’

China’s long fight with deflation risks morphing into something harsher, with economists warning the war in Iran could ​spark “bad inflation” at a time when chronically weak consumption and fading external demand leave the economy with little cushion. Beijing’s deep strategic oil reserves, diversified energy mix ‌and tightly regulated energy market give it a buffer few developed economies enjoy, particularly in Europe, where stagflation risks are rising.
